WASHINGTON (WUSA) -- When planning your summer vacation budget, there's one thing you may forget: tips. Kiplinger.com reports it always helps to have a bunch of small bills with you.

Hotel housekeepers usually get $2 to $5 a day. A good rule of thumb is $1 per bed made each day.

Airport shuttle drivers should get a dollar or two when they handle your bags.

Give a parking valet $2 to $5 each time you pick up your car. But in some places, tipping is included so you should read the fine print.

Also, remember to brush up on the customs before you go overseas -- rules may be different.
